My wonderful bridesmaid Brittany threw Mr. Lab and me an amazing engagement party a few weeks ago. Another bridesmaid, Ashley, my MOH, Amanda, as well as some of Brittany’s roommates, helped out with the decorations and food setup. I could not believe how fabulous the party was. I expected just a few bottles of wine and some cheese (since I knew the guests were expected to bring either a bottle of wine or a block of cheese), but I had no idea that they would have so many delicious hors d’oeuvres as well! The girls really outdid themselves. They made me wonder if hiring a caterer for the reception is really necessary… ;)

Brittany started out by sending adorable Evites to the guests. Here’s the main banner of the invitation:

We topped off the party with a game of toilet paper wedding dresses! We split the guests up into groups and they had to design a wedding gown out of toilet paper on their “models” (which were all guys!). I then picked my favorite one by calling it pageant-style with runner-ups until the winner was announced. Trey’s (he’s the second from the left with the “veil” covering his face) team won, which ironically consisted of Brittany and Amanda! I picked them because he had a sweetheart, trumpet-style gown, which was closest to what my gown looks like! But I do have to say that the bow on Mr. Lab’s butt was fabulous, as well! ;)
